## Environments: Calvert Sync Service

Staging and production share the Norwall calendar backend, which caused duplicate invite events during the March conflict. We now pin each environment to its own tenant and disable cross-tenant mirroring. Maintainers should never point staging at the production tenant, even temporarily. If sync conflicts reappear, check the tenant pinning first. The current environment configuration values are listed below.

deployment values, yadug-bawif:
[framir]
team = pelox
access_code = ac_a38ab2
owner = tamion.julael
host = framir.tolvaqlabs.test
port = 11211
peer = tammir.zemvargrid.local
salt = 2215ef03
pin = 1541

Onboarding note for the weekly eng sync: the Spoolwise CSV import wizard. Quick intro for newcomers — Spoolwise is how Marrowgate customers bulk-load catalog rows. The wizard validates headers, previews the first fifty rows, and flags type mismatches before anything touches the database. One quirk: the wizard's service login locks after idle weekends, which stalls Monday demos. Anyone on rotation can recover it from the admin panel by typing the recovery passphrase that appears right below this paragraph.

unlock words, yagag-yahog: gordor-zorvan-druius-queniel-normir-norwyn-framir-novmir-ralius-holwyn-wenwyn-tamael-silok-holdor

**Release checklist — breaker for the Quillfeather API**

Quick one for the sync: before we ship, someone needs to flip on the new circuit breaker wrapping calls to the Quillfeather pricing API. It trips after five consecutive failures and half-opens after 30 seconds — don't tweak those without pinging Mara. Verify the fallback returns cached quotes, not empty payloads like last time. Run the chaos script in staging and confirm the breaker state transitions show up in Glimmerboard. Record the canary build you validated against right below.

pipeline stamp: htk9_6ce9d33c5

# Break-Glass Access — GrainPulse Telemetry Gateway

If the gateway at the Hollowfen test farm stops relaying tractor telemetry and normal auth is down, you're cleared to use break-glass. Ping whoever's secondary on-call first, log the incident, and rotate creds afterward — no exceptions. To unlock the emergency console, use the recovery passphrase given just below.

unlock words, tagaf-hahif: ralwyn-lammir-rusax-sormir